Remodeling of Zn2+ homeostasis upon differentiation of mammary epithelial cells

Abstract: Zinc is the second most abundant transition metal in humans and an essential nutrient required for growth and development of newborns.

“…Zn 2+ has a protective effect on renal ischemia-reperfusion injury by augmenting superoxide dismutase activity and lowering the Bax/Bcl-2 expression ratio to reduce apoptosis [37]. Therefore, our results support that ZnO-NP, at sub-lethal dosage, causes a mild elevation of [Zn 2+ ] i which has been shown to enhance the expression of metallothioneins [46] and the activity of Zn 2+ -related superoxide dismutase [47]. Both metallothioneins and dismutase can lower the ROS level leading to the down-regulation of the expression of p53 and Bax/Bcl-2 ratio [47,48].…”

“…75 The Zn + is essential for the expression of milk proteins during the terminal differentiation of MECs. 76 The Rab proteins are GTPases involved in the transport of proteins between different intracellular compartments. The protein Rab5b mediates the internalization of prolactin and phosphorylation of STAT5 molecules, 77 which induces milk protein genes' expression during the terminal differentiation of MECs.…”
